Brewery cats and the Grateful Dead highlight this week’s News & Brews.

After a run of (mostly) malty fall beers, the switch was made this week to a classic golden ale — Seventh Son’s Assistant Manger, named for the brewery’s beloved brewery cat. Did the can art play a role in the beer’s selection? Of course it did.

In addition to praising the aforementioned can art of Seventh Son and other local brewers, this week’s talk dives a little bit into wet hopped beers and rotating hop IPAs, spurred by Columbus Brewing Co.’s recent decision to dump a batch of a popular seasonal IPA that didn’t meet its standards.

Columbus Business First is launching a Grateful Dead Networking meet-up, the first of which will be Tuesday Oct. 29 at Columbus Brewing.

News-wise Land-Grant Brewing has an interesting collaboration beer, Saucy Brew Works provided and update on its Harrison West brewpub and one of Ohio’s largest wineries has a new Columbus-based owner whose name might ring a bell.

In News & Brews great tradition of plugging podcasts that aren’t our own, Office Ladies gets a shout-out this week before the discussions turns toward Millennial love for The Office television show, but otherwise tangents mostly stick to the topic of local alcohol news.
